WebJan 2, 2010 · The idea is to route coolant from a point of pump pressure to a point of pump suction. The heater circuit also provides a coolant bypass thru the pump when the engine is cold and the thermostat is closed. This speeds warming the engine and quickly provides cabin heat in winter months. WebJan 20, 2024 · The heads will heat up much faster, and will also be a hotter temp all the time. I measured both locations on my 327, and before my 170 degree T stat opened the head 1/3 location was already at around 190-200 degrees. Once the stat opens it drops, but still read 10-15 degrees higher than the intake manifold location. WebApr 19, 2006 · Feb 4, 2002. 5,942. Hollister CA USA. Most completely dry SBC chevy cooling systems hold just over 3 gallons, radiator size plays a big role in the overall coolant capacity though. Unless you can jack the car up 90* you wont get all the coolant out because the water pump passges are located near the top of the deck. Apr 17, 2006.

WebJun 24, 2024 · Any small block engine, regardless of year, that uses Vortec heads, will require an external coolant bypass line from the intake manifold to the 5/8" hose nipple on the water pump (passenger’s side). Suggested routing is from the 3/8" boss on intake manifold to the water pump."
